What Are the Differences Between Granny and Granny 2?
Both Granny and Granny 2 are survival horror games that challenge you to escape from a creepy environment while being hunted. However, survival in Granny 2 is more challenging because Granny and Grandpa are both hunting you down at the same time. The house in the sequel is larger and more complex, featuring more rooms to explore, more weapon options, and more tools to collect. It also offers additional escape routes—boat and helicopter escapes on top of the classic main door—each with its own set of items, challenges, and puzzles to solve.
Two Hunters Instead of One
Granny and Grandpa patrol the house with different behaviors, forcing you to learn their patterns and plan routes that avoid both threats at once.
Bigger, More Complex House
Granny 2’s environment is larger than the original Granny, with extra floors, hidden areas, and more rooms packed with clues, tools, and dangers.
Multiple Escape Routes
Find your way out through the main door, the boat, or the helicopter. Each escape route has unique requirements—specific keys, tools, and steps you must complete in the correct order.
Five Difficulty Levels
Just like the first Granny, Granny 2 includes five difficulty options, letting you choose everything from an easier exploration run to a brutally hard survival challenge.
How to Play Granny 2
Find the Way to Get Out
Search the house for tools, keys, and pieces of equipment needed for each escape route. For the main door, you must remove multiple locks; for the boat and helicopter, you need to assemble and fuel them before you can flee.
Desktop Controls
Use WASD to move, E to pick up or interact, Space to drop items, F to remove bear traps, C to crouch, and R to hide. Use the left mouse button to shoot when you have a weapon equipped.
Stay Quiet and Plan Ahead
Avoid making noise that attracts Granny and Grandpa. Watch and listen for their movements, plan your route, and always keep an escape path in mind before you move into a new area.
